(Domaine Perrot-Minot Bourgogne) Light medium red color with 5 millimeter clear meniscus; nice, light, rosehips, tart cherry nose; tasty, tart cherry, tart raspberry palate with surprising depth and elegance for a Bourgogne; medium finish (great value for about $26)

Martine's Wines Portfolio tasting (MK, Chicago IL): nose: good and correct nose of brown spices and red cherries. Nice and easy that acts as one would expect from a bourgogne
taste: light and easy with medium/low acidity and one dimensional notes of red cherries
overall: a good bourgogne. One dimensional and correct but not much more
